CITY OF SANTA ANA <br />SPECIFICATIONS <br />PROJECT NO.: XX-XXXX <br />PROJECT TITLE <br /> <br />72 <br />3.00 SPECIAL PROVISIONS - TRAFFIC CONTROL <br />3.01 GENERAL <br />Street closures, detours, signs and barricades used for handling traffic shall conform to <br />the requirements of latest edition of the “Work Area Traffic Control Handbook” <br />(WATCH), City of Santa Ana Standard Plan No. 1125F, California Manual on Uniform <br />Traffic Control Devices (CA MUTCD), and these Special Provisions. <br />Traffic control plan must be submitted and approved before starting work on any public <br />street, except for the following temporary closures: <br /> Temporary single lane closure on 4 or 6-lane arterials can be done per WATCH <br />handbook without submitting traffic control plan. <br /> Temporary two lanes closure on 6-lane arterials may be done per WATCH <br />handbook without submitting traffic control plan. However, this will require prior <br />approval from Traffic Engineer. <br /> Temporary closure of local streets may be done per WATCH handbook without <br />submitting traffic control plan. However, this will require prior approval from <br />Traffic Engineer. <br />Flashing arrow signs shall be used on streets consisting of four or more lanes or where <br />deemed necessary by the City’s Traffic Engineering section. The flashing arrow signs <br />shall be solar powered and left in place for the duration of the lane closure. <br />Temporary striping installation for traffic control shall be painted. <br />Any existing speed limit signs or other conflicting signs in the construction zone shall be <br />covered during construction with heavy duty black plastic (non-transparent) sheets or <br />bags, which are secured to the sign post below the sign, with tape. In no case shall tape <br />be applied to either front or back of any sign. <br />Intersections shall be kept open until work takes place within the intersection. Local <br />vehicular and pedestrian access, including access to driveways and businesses, shall be <br />maintained at all times. Pedestrian access (minimum 4-foot width) across both streets in <br />an intersection must be maintained at all times. <br />Where parking is prohibited during construction, "TEMPORARY NO PARKING" signs <br />shall be posted at least twenty-four hours, but no more than forty-eight hours, in advance <br />of the work. The signs shall be placed no more than 150 feet apart on each side of the <br />alleys, streets and parking areas and at shorter intervals if conditions warrant. Th e <br />Contractor shall provide the signs and will be responsible for adding the dates and hours <br />of closure to the signs. <br />No adjacent parallel street shall be constructed concurrently. <br />505 E Central Ave <br />#B11/6/2024
